Unhappy Broken valve spring

I've got a street 400 that has now broken two valve springs. The first one was on the exhaust and I replaced it with a stock spring. That was a few thousand miles ago. Now, an intake spring is broken (at least this one didn't take the lifter and pushrod with it!).

I'm told that my cam has too much lift for a stock-type valve-train and the heads must come off for some work. Lift is .463/.485. I'd like to verify that before I go to the trouble to pull the heads, but I'm not sure how to verify it. My google and forum searches have been fruitless.

Suggestions? Ideas?

You most prolly are having a retainer to guide clearance issue and/or coil bind. 485 lift on stock springs and uncut guides is too much.
